  • Qianshan Mountain
    󰺂6.7
    147.26
    Anshan.Qianshan Scenic Area39.8 km from Haicheng
    Highlights:
    Autumn leaves attract photographers
    󱓊Panoramic view from Five Buddha Peak
    󱨠5247 positive reviews
    4.7/5
    可爱的旅游生活89可爱的旅游生活89

    Qianshan combines 3.8 billion years of strange rocks and mountains with a thousand years of Buddhist and Taoist culture. Nearly a thousand lotus-shaped peaks stand tall, ancient temples are hidden among the green cypresses, and landscapes such as the flat stone and the one-character sky are both challenging and fun. The sunrise and starry sky are also very beautiful.

  • Liaoning Provincial Museum
    󰺂7.2
    Shenyang.Liaoning Provincial Museum/Taoxian International AirportMore than 100 km from Haicheng
    Highlights:
    󱓊110,000 relics including jade & bronze
    󱓊11,000 artifacts & paintings
    󱨠Saved by 194 users󱨠1330 positive reviews
    4.9/5
    午后时光~午后时光~

    5 out of 10! The Liaoning Provincial Museum is Shenyang's hidden cultural treasure; a whole day isn't enough! As the first museum in New China, the Liaoning Provincial Museum truly embodies the spirit of "understated yet rich in content"! Free admission and directly accessible by Metro Line 2 (Exit D, just a 150-meter walk), it's incredibly convenient, requiring no navigation. The architecture is magnificent and grand, with a clear exhibition layout. The 22 exhibition halls cover 17 categories of collections, including prehistoric culture, Liao Dynasty artifacts, and calligraphy and painting masterpieces, with over 115,000 artifacts to explore—a paradise for history buffs! The must-see exhibits are truly breathtaking! The white jade pig-dragon from the Hongshan Culture is exquisite; its rounded shape is both ancient and mysterious, a marvel of 5,000-year-old carving techniques. Zhang Xu's "Four Poems in Ancient Style" features unrestrained cursive script; even the ink smudges are clearly visible under magnification, exuding the grandeur of the Tang Dynasty. There's also the Murong Xianbei's gold hairpin shaped like a flowering tree and the Yongzheng kiln-fired red-glazed pomegranate-shaped vase—both aesthetically pleasing and historically significant. For a deeper understanding, I recommend renting a VR audio guide for 50 yuan. It not only provides detailed explanations but also comes with a postcard, making it far more rewarding than wandering around aimlessly. Don't miss the volunteer guides either, as they are packed with information! The exhibition hall is vast, so comfortable shoes are recommended. Allow at least 3-4 hours for a leisurely visit. There's a restaurant on the first floor for a light meal, and the "Hairpin Flower" series of souvenirs in the cultural and creative area are very attractive—perfect for gifts or personal enjoyment. The only minor drawback is that some of the museum's most prized artifacts (such as the "Auspicious Cranes" painting) may be temporarily closed for conservation purposes; check the official website for announcements before you go. Whether you're introducing history to your children or experiencing cultural heritage with friends, the Liaoning Provincial Museum is worth visiting multiple times! Every artifact here tells a story spanning thousands of years. After a visit, you'll be deeply moved by the profoundness of Chinese culture. Don't miss it when you're in Shenyang!

  • Marshal Zhang's Mansion Museum
    󰺂8.5
    3.69
    Shenyang.The Imperial Palace/Xiaoheyan Morning MarketMore than 100 km from Haicheng
    Highlights:
    5 buildings show Zhang Xueliang's life
    Explore the restoration scenario of the Original Frontier Bank
    󱨠Saved by 333 users󱨠29911 positive reviews
    4.7/5
    AndrewTsuiAndrewTsui

    Located in the Zhongjie Tourist Area, along with Shenyang Imperial Palace and Liu Laogen Grand Stage, Zhang Xueliang's Former Residence is just a few hundred meters from the Imperial Palace, so there's no need to take a taxi. If you only visit the residence and skip the Financial Museum and the Enamel Exhibition, the entrance fee is very cheap, only around ten yuan. I didn't visit the other two smaller attractions due to time constraints. Along the way, there are unofficial guides offering explanations; this is optional. I had done my research beforehand, so I didn't need anyone to tell me anything—I could explain everything myself. The residence is divided into the old house and the new house, with the main attraction being the new house. Popular items include some of Zhang Xueliang's personal belongings from his later years, donated by his family, including a Mickey Mouse hat—all original and very valuable. The entire visit should take about two hours, so allow plenty of time.
